FOR IMMEDIATE RELEASE (Philadelphia, PA, April 27, 2016) –– The Kimmel Center for the Performing Arts, in partnership with Mark Cortale Productions, announces the next installment in Seth Rudetsky’s Broadway Concert Series, with the incomparable Megan Hilty taking the stage of the Merriam Theater for a one-night-only performance on May 17 at 8:00 p.m. Seth will perform alongside Megan as host and pianist for the evening. The show features the dynamic duo performing a myriad of songs, including fresh takes on classic Broadway ballads.

“Megan Hilty is the ultimate triple threat: beauty, talent, and comedy,” said Anne Ewers, President & CEO of the Kimmel Center for the Performing Arts. “With Megan and Seth sharing the stage, there’s sure to be plenty of witty banter, hilarious anecdotes, and not to mention, the best of Broadway.”

Megan Hilty is best known as the 'Bombshell' star of the NBC’s hit series Smash. She has also appeared on Broadway as Glinda in Wicked and opposite Allison Janney and Stephanie Block in the musical comedy adaptation of 9 to 5, as well as a guest star on many television dramas and comedies. A wonderful vocalist as well as a gifted actress, Megan was last seen on Broadway this winter in the revival of the slapstick farce classic Noises Off with Andrea Martin.

The Seth Rudetsky Broadway Concert Series showcases Sirius XM Radio Star Seth Rudetsky as pianist and host, asking probing, funny and revealing questions of Broadways biggest stars. Earlier in the Kimmel Center for the Performing Arts 2015-2016 season, Broadway phenomenon Audra McDonald joined Seth on stage as part of this series and this summer, Kelli O’Hara will close it out on June 14. In addition to his Broadway Concert Series at the Kimmel Center for the Performing Arts, this March, Seth premiered his new Broadway musical comedy, Disaster!, currently playing at theNederlander Theatre in New York City.

Kimmel Center for the Performing Arts

Located in the heart of Center City, Philadelphia, the Kimmel Center’s mission is to operate a world-class performing arts center that engages and serves a broad audience through diverse programming, arts education, and community outreach. The Kimmel Center campus is comprised of the Kimmel Center for the Performing Arts (Verizon Hall, Perelman Theater, SEI Innovation Studio, and the Merck Arts Education Center), the Academy of Music (owned by the Philadelphia Orchestra Association), and the University of the Arts’ Merriam Theater.
